As the world transitions to cleaner energy sources, the electric vehicle (EV) market is experiencing rapid growth, with numerous manufacturers investing heavily in the sector. A new report highlights how the competitiveness of electric vehicles is shaping investment decisions, with companies prioritizing cost-effectiveness, range, and charging infrastructure. The report suggests that EV makers are under increasing pressure to reduce costs and improve performance, with some manufacturers opting for more affordable battery technologies. Meanwhile, governments are also playing a crucial role in driving EV adoption through incentives and subsidies, further fueling the industry's growth.
